Pros

No doubt, it's a best company to work. Good work life balance. Defenetly recommend to my friends. Have good career opportunities.

Cons

In recent days, we see a step down in internal fairness. When a request comes from an employee (A good resource server about 7 years), management denies. But when the same request comes from another employee, management denies, later after few days we heard that they have agreed. This will make other employees down and feel partiality at workplace.

Thank you for sharing your concerns. Fairness is a big priority at LiveVox, and we have designed our people processes and decision-support frameworks to support it. From hiring and promotion criteria, to compensation decisions, our consideration and approval processes ensure we consider internal comparison for fairness. Fairness permeates decisions around all employee requests so it’s tough to respond to this post without knowing the situation. But, in general, there are many considerations that impact decision-making about special requests. Employee tenure is only one and while important, it is never the only one. Others are employee’s performance and capability, the type of work the employee does, the state of their workgroup, the type of work in process at the time of the request and the known work coming up soon. All these matters are considered when employee’s make special requests. After discussing this GlassDoor post feedback with the management team, we felt it may have been in response to an employee’s request to continue working in their job in another country in which LiveVox does not have an office or even a legal entity. LiveVox had rarely had employee requests of this nature before, and recently had a few requests. After all the relevant issues were considered, some requests were approved and some denied. After getting this feedback, we see we may not have effectively explained our decision-making criteria. We have now designed a policy to fully describeour decision framework for such requests.
